Media Case Study |
Teed Business Continuity has worked extensively with a client in the media sector to ensure that their essential services, including their contact centres, would continue to operate should an adverse situation arise. This involved conducting a business impact analysis and risk assessment and reviewing the existing contingencies to determine any gaps in the current strategy. A revised strategy was then agreed and relevant business continuity plans were subsequently created and exercised.
We were also engaged by a major television station to exercise their crisis management team and provide recommendations for improving their incident response and recovery strategies to align them more closely with best practice. |
